If you know anything about GG Allins back story it's pretty sad

>Son of a military brat who was discharged for using and selling heroin
>Both he and his mother were held hostage by his father at gunpoint when he was eight, leading to a police standoff
>Beaten by both his stepfather and his uncle
>Sent to a mental institution where he was misdiagnosed and became suicidal after having new drugs tested on him
>All this before he was 18

>be classically trained in music
>literally post an ad in the paper to audition people to join his band
>audition mick jagger and keith richards
>form and name the rolling stones
>introduce non-standard instruments to the band, such as the sitar on paint in black, recorder on ruby tuesday, dulcimer on lady jane, marimbas on under my thumb
>get the band gigs, and overall be the leader of the band.
>band mates all drink and drug up
>also drink and drug up but develop a problem but it's okay because at least you have your band to play in.
>band kicks you out
>drown in a swimming pool at 27
>half the band doesn't even show up to your funeral and continue to milk their success for the next 45 years without ever mentioning you xP
